Divine Beast Dancing Lion location in Elden Ring DLC
The Dancing Lion is the ultimate boss in Belurat legacy dungeon and makes its dwelling within the theater space close to the settlement’s highest stage. It’s the dungeon’s finish level and, ultimately, a compulsory location you’ll go to throughout the DLC’s principal storyline.
Like with all of Shadow of the Erdtree’s main bosses, there’s a web site of grace simply outdoors, together with a Stake of Marika for summoning human assist, and a single golden summoning mark that permits you to deliver an NPC ally into battle.
Divine Beast Dancing Lion weaknesses and methods to put together
So far as I may inform, throughout greater than a dozen battles, the Dancing Lion has no standing ailment vulnerabilities. It received’t bleed, it shakes off poison, and I noticed no impact from rot and deathblight.
On the brilliant aspect, it’s extra inclined than most main bosses to having its poise damaged when you use the proper of weapon or spell, which leaves it open to important hits that take a pleasant chunk out of its HP bar.

Good timing and motion are extra vital than particular weapons for this combat, although you would possibly need to contemplate shelving heavy weapons that transfer slowly. The Dancing Lion is something however gradual, and there’s likelihood it should have moved on earlier than you end prepping your assault. Greatswords and hammers work properly, as do thrusting and straight swords. The Blackgaol Knight’s sword and the Anvil Hammer from Gravesite Plain’s Ruined Lava Forge are two sturdy choices in case your construct is geared towards energy and dexterity.
Magic customers can keep on with their favourite intelligence- or faith-scaling weapon. It must be an endgame weapon, although. Our picks are the Darkmoon Greatsword, Onyx Lord’s Greatsword, Dying’s Poker, and Royal Greatsword from Blaidd’s quest are strong decisions for intelligence builds, and Golden Order Greatsword or Blasphemous Blade for religion builds.
That stated, this boss combat is one which favors spells as properly. You’ve a number of possibilities to place sufficient distance between your self and the Dancing Lion to the place you possibly can safely fling a couple of sorceries earlier than having to relocate, and the perfect — and best to solid even for religion builds choice is Rock Sling. 4 or 5 hits from this spell will break the Dancing Lion’s poise and depart it open to a important hit, when you strike quick sufficient along with your melee weapon.

Your weapon must be maxed out, ideally, however you will get by with a +7 weapon when you’re lacking weapon improve supplies.
You’ll be able to summon the NPC Redmane Freyja for this combat and use a Spirit Ash summon of your individual. Though a boss’ HP will increase if you use NPC or human summons, I like to recommend bringing Freyja into battle for at the least your first few makes an attempt. The Dancing Lion’s strikes are erratic and in contrast to just about something within the base recreation, and it takes observe to grasp the appropriate timing. Freyja and your Spirit Ash hold it occupied so you possibly can take pot photographs with spells, sneak some melee strikes in, and learn the way its assaults work from a protected distance.

Tanky summons like Lhutel aren’t tanky sufficient to final various hits from the Dancing Lion, so keep away from utilizing them. Refill on Ghost Glovewort for Spirit Ash upgrades, when you haven’t already, and decide up some Bell Bearings when you’ve exhausted the pure provide of Glovewort.
Lastly, you would possibly need to have some Thawing Boluses readily available, relying on how properly you fare throughout the combat’s later levels.
The way to beat the Divine Beast Dancing Lion in Elden Ring DLC
The Dancing Lion combat is a difficult battle that calls for a extra agile and adaptable technique than earlier Elden Ring bosses, and the one strategy to study what to not do is to make errors — so much. If you happen to can, contemplate recording the combat so you possibly can play it again and study with out the stress of not dying.
rule of thumb that applies to the entire combat is that, if the beast continues to be, you need to hit it a few times earlier than retreating. The strategy I used to put on the Lion down was casting Rock Sling to interrupt its poise, then speeding in for a important strike, lingering to execute a couple of melee assaults, and repeating the method. The caveat is that this technique is simply straightforward to make use of in case you have summons to distract the Lion, which implies as soon as they vanish later within the combat — as they nearly certainly will — you’ll need to depend on one thing extra hands-on.
Divine Beast Dancing Lion boss combat section 1

The Divine Beast has a number of assaults within the first section, together with one which may end you off in a single hit. The commonest is a three-move combo the place the Lion rears again and dives ahead, then spins in a circle, and dives ahead barely extra earlier than ending with an upward head thrust. If you happen to’re shut, the Lion will generally forego its massive swirly animation in favor of a lunging chunk, so keep in your toes.
One of the simplest ways to cope with all variations of this assault is to dodge ahead when the Lion first dives at you. Its first assault will miss, and if it finishes the combo, you received’t be anyplace shut sufficient to take injury. It typically stops the combo and strikes to one thing else after the primary assault misses, although, so assault a couple of occasions and transfer to security.

There’s an annoying quirk the place the digital camera goes haywire when you’re proper close to the Lion whereas it’s shifting, which makes focusing on and dodging a nightmare. Dodging ahead has the additional advantage of making sufficient distance between you so this case doesn’t occur.
The Dancing Lion’s chunk is actually extra harmful than its bark. It can generally rear again, snap its jaws collectively a couple of occasions, then lunge ahead. If it makes contact, it swings you round in its mouth and chomps a number of occasions, dealing heavy injury — sufficient to fully deplete your HP if it’s not full. Dodging ahead exactly when it lunges will get you previous this assault as properly, and the Lion takes a couple of seconds to get well when it misses, providing you with the proper likelihood to make use of some heavy assaults and put on it down a little bit quicker.

The Dancing Lion has a number of particles assaults it alternates between, relying in your distance. The primary one sees it spew an arc of mud and stone at you, which it’s essential dodge or dash sideways to keep away from. Much less frequent is a variation of this the place it belches a single stream of particles as an alternative, although dodging sideways works right here as properly. These assaults normally occur when you’re at a distance, and so they hold you from spamming spells like Comet Azur except another person distracts the Lion.
While you’re nearer, the Dancing Lion stands on its again legs, vomits particles, and spins in a full circle 3 times. You’ll be able to dodge backwards and run away from it or dodge sideways, keep shut, and assault, when you’re feeling courageous.

The digital camera problem pops up if you’re too shut throughout this assault as properly, so bear that in thoughts. The Lion ends this with a backflip that smacks you arduous when you’re too shut. There’s a window of a couple of second or two after this the place you possibly can rush in and assault earlier than retreating, so get your self prepared as soon as the Lion spins for the third time.
The ultimate variation includes only one spin and an arc of particles.
Issues get much more intense as soon as the Lion’s HP drops by a couple of third of its whole.
Divine Beast Dancing Lion boss combat section 2

From right here on, the Dancing Lion ditches particles and alternates between lightning, ice, and wind as an alternative, every with a couple of slight assault sample variations. Lightning is at all times first. The Lion nonetheless makes use of its spewing assaults, solely with lightning now. It additionally throws a spear of lightning at you that explodes — and a second one when you efficiently dodge the primary — and its lunge assaults summon lightning in an X-shape that strikes and explodes after a couple of seconds. The bottom sparkles in locations the place lightning goes to strike, and also you’ll have a second to dodge away earlier than it hits.

The Lion switches to both ice or wind subsequent, although ice was the commonest second ingredient in my expertise. Its assaults are the identical on this section, besides as an alternative of exploding like lightning, the ice it summons lingers on the sphere for a couple of moments earlier than exploding — much like the Hoarfrost Stomp impact. It builds Frostbite when you’re caught within the explosion, and if the meter maxes out, you are taking injury and have decrease protection for a short while. Attempt dodging outdoors the affected space when you can, although in case your timing is excellent, you possibly can bounce earlier than it explodes. Retreat and use Thawing Boluses to reset the Frostbite gauge if you need to.

The wind section works a little bit in a different way. The Dancing Lion nonetheless lunges, but it surely’s extra more likely to whip up a couple of whirlwinds. Probably the most highly effective of those occurs when the Lion spins in midair and creates a correct tornado. The funnel strikes towards you, and if it connects, it offers injury and launches you into the air for a second. Dodge ahead to flee this assault. Don’t attempt shifting sideways, because the twister is simply too broad and can launch you anyway.
The Lion additionally spews a tunnel of air at you, which you’ll be able to dodge sideways to keep away from, and it creates small whirlwinds when it lunges.
The Dancing Lion whirls within the air for 2 seconds or so when it modifications parts, and there’s an additional second after the change earlier than it does something. Use this second to retreat and heal if it’s essential, or fireplace off some spells.
Whatever the ingredient, your offensive technique ought to stay principally the identical. Use the moments after lunges to assault with melee weapons, and make far between your self and the Lion to make use of spells.
Divine Beast Dancing Lion boss combat section 3

Calling this a 3rd section is a little bit little bit of a stretch, because the Dancing Lion doesn’t use any new assaults. Nonetheless, it does alternate between parts far more rapidly, with fewer possibilities so that you can catch your breath. You’ll must assume rapidly and play a bit extra aggressively to take the Lion down earlier than it wears you out, and when you held off summoning your Spirit Ash earlier, now’s the time to do it.
Defeating the Lion earns you a Remembrance for Enia again at Roundtable Maintain and the Lion’s head as a bit of armor.

“That’s gross,” you would possibly say, and it sort of is, however when you put on it and converse to the Hornsent Grandam in Belurat’s storage room — a locked space close to the Small Altar Website of Grace — you’ll get a brand new Incantation on your troubles.
